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| arrow-poison-tree | Hedge Barberry |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Gentianales (Gentianales) | Ranunculales (Ranunculales) |
| Family | Apocynaceae | Berberidaceae |
| Genus | Acokanthera | Berberis |
| Species | Acokanthera schimperi | Berberis stenophylla |
Evolutionary Relationship
arrow-poison-tree and Hedge Barberry share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
